About the Community: 
With a population of 11,500, Zebulon is Wake County's easternmost town and is located just 20 miles from North Carolina's Capital City of Raleigh. Zebulon is a charming small town known as "The Town of Friendly People.” Residents enjoy a small-town feel while having all the amenities and access to Raleigh’s metropolitan area of 1.5 million people. Experiencing similar growth patterns to the region, the Town's population grows and diversifies by as many as seven people daily. Current strategic planning and development forecasts estimate that Zebulon's population will nearly double by 2030.
 
Wake County and its communities have received national and international rankings and accolades from publications such as Money, Fortune, and Time magazines as one of the best places to live and work. Its world-class healthcare, higher education, public school system (the largest in the state), and variety of entertainment provide ample opportunities for Zebulon’s residents. Zebulon is bordered by four counties and boasts easy access to many points of interest, including Raleigh-Durham International Airport and Research Triangle Park. The town is approximately 3 hours from the mountains of North Carolina and 2 hours from Atlantic Coast beaches.
